  • "First Apple Watch Data: One Just Isn't Enough" ["Among those buying an Apple Watch, 72 percent purchased an Apple product in the past two years (iPhone, Apple computer or iPad), and 21 percent of them pre-ordered an iPhone 6 or iPhone 6 Plus mere months ago. Nearly one-third purchased two Apple products and 11 percent bought all three devices, in addition to their new watch. As expected,  most consumers–62 percent– purchased the less-expensive Sport model. However,  many Apple Watch buyers invested in the pricier case but the cheapest band, with more than one third adding a black or white Sport band."]  Slice Intelligence 8:46 PM
